    Real Betis host Osasuna on La Liga matchday No. 3 with both sides sitting in the top four. Los Verdiblancos are third in the Primera with six points from six on offer.

    Osasuna are fourth having also picked up six points from six points on offer this season. Both sides are in excellent form at both ends of the pitch.

    Manuel Pellegrini’s team defeated Elche 3-0 on opening day and followed it up with a 2-1 away win at Mallorca. Neither of Real Betis’s opening matches were against La Liga’s strongest teams. In fact, both Elche and Mallorca have collected a total of one combined point.

    Osasuna, on the other hand, shocked Sevilla to start the season 2-1. Los Rojillos then won 2-0 versus Cadiz. Osasuna played their two opening matches at El Sadar, which surely helped them claim two impressive wins.

    Real Betis have a strong head-to-head record against Osasuna. Los Verdiblancos have a record of 5W-0D-1L in all competitions against Osasuna in the teams’ last six head-to-head meetings.

    One of the surprise aspects of La Liga this season has been the strength of away teams. Away teams have won 45% of matches in La Liga compared to just 30% of home teams winning games. There is a strong possibility of an away win in this game, which would be an upset.

    Pellegrini has four players on the injury list heading into the match. Defender Youssouf Sabaly is a doubt with a muscle injury. Defender Martin Montoya is ruled out until mid-September with an ankle injury.

    Midfielders Victor Camarasa has discomfort and is a doubt while Sergio Canales is also a doubt following physical discomfort.

    Real Betis are led in goals by Borja Iglesias with three this season. Los Verdiblancos have scored five goals in La Liga with Iglesias bagging three of them.

    Goals have not been shared by the team, which is a worry. Juami has added the other two goals for Betis.

    Osasuna coach Jagoba Arrasate will be without forward Kike Saverio. The forward has a tendon injury that will keep him out of action. Ezequiel Avila has bagged two of Osasuna’s four goals this season.
